Kuiper边缘计算:重塑分布式数据处理的新范式
2025.10.10 16:17浏览量:1简介:本文深入探讨Kuiper边缘计算框架的技术特性、应用场景及实践价值,解析其如何通过轻量化架构与实时流处理能力,解决工业物联网、智慧城市等领域的低延迟数据处理难题,并提供从部署到优化的全流程指导。
一、Kuiper边缘计算的技术定位与核心价值
在5G与物联网设备爆发式增长的背景下,传统云计算模式面临带宽瓶颈与实时性挑战。Kuiper作为LF Edge基金会旗下的开源边缘流处理引擎,通过”边缘节点-云端协同”架构,将数据处理能力下沉至离数据源最近的物理节点,实现毫秒级响应。其核心价值体现在三方面:
- 低延迟决策:在工业传感器网络中,Kuiper可直接在网关设备上执行异常检测规则,避免将GB级原始数据上传至云端,将故障响应时间从秒级压缩至10ms以内。
- 带宽优化:某智慧园区项目实测显示,通过Kuiper的本地聚合过滤功能,上传数据量减少82%,同时保证关键事件100%捕获。
- 离线自治:在轨道交通场景中,Kuiper支持断网环境下的持续运行,网络恢复后自动同步差异数据,保障业务连续性。
二、技术架构深度解析
1. 模块化设计
Kuiper采用”插件式”架构,核心组件包括:
- SQL引擎:支持标准SQL语法及自定义扩展函数,开发者可通过
CREATE STREAM语句快速定义数据流:CREATE STREAM demoStream (temperature FLOAT,humidity FLOAT,timestamp BIGINT) WITH (DATASOURCE="mqtt://sensors", FORMAT="json");
- 规则引擎:基于有限状态机实现复杂事件处理(CEP),支持滑动窗口、时间窗口等时序分析模式。
- 扩展接口:提供Go语言SDK,允许开发者自定义数据源(如Modbus协议)、分析函数(如傅里叶变换)及输出目标(如InfluxDB时序数据库)。
2. 资源优化策略
针对嵌入式设备资源受限问题,Kuiper实施三项关键优化:
- 内存池管理:通过对象复用机制将内存碎片率控制在5%以下,在树莓派4B上稳定处理5000条/秒的数据流。
- 动态编译:规则更新时仅重新编译变更部分,将重启耗时从分钟级降至秒级。
- 多级缓存:设置热点数据L1/L2缓存,使复杂查询响应速度提升3倍。
三、典型应用场景与实施路径
1. 工业预测性维护
某汽车制造厂部署方案:
- 设备层:在CNC机床PLC旁部署Kuiper边缘节点,实时采集振动、温度等200+参数。
- 分析层:配置时序异常检测规则:
SELECT * FROM machineStreamWHERE ABS(temperature - MOVING_AVG(temperature, 60)) > 3*STDDEV(temperature, 60)
- 执行层:触发报警时自动调用本地API关闭设备,同步将事件详情上传至云端AI模型进行根因分析。
实施效果:设备意外停机减少67%,维护成本降低42%。
2. 智慧交通信号控制
城市交通管理局实践案例:
- 数据融合:通过Kuiper整合摄像头、地磁线圈、GPS浮动车等多源数据,生成实时路况热力图。
- 动态配时:基于强化学习算法动态调整信号灯周期,试点区域通行效率提升28%。
- 边缘协同:相邻路口Kuiper节点通过MQTT协议共享车流预测数据,实现区域级联动控制。
四、部署与优化实战指南
1. 硬件选型建议
| 场景 | 推荐配置 | 性能指标要求 |
|---|---|---|
| 轻量级监控 | 树莓派4B(4GB RAM) | CPU占用<30%,内存<200MB |
| 工业网关 | 研华UNO-2271G(i5-8365UE) | 支持4G/Wi-Fi双模,-20~70℃ |
| 车载计算单元 | NVIDIA Jetson AGX Xavier | 32TOPS AI算力,10W功耗 |
2. 性能调优技巧
- 规则优化:避免在WHERE子句中使用复杂函数,优先通过索引字段过滤。
- 并行处理:对CPU密集型规则设置
OPTIONS.workerNum=4启用多线程。 - 日志管理:配置
logLevel=warn减少IO开销,异常时通过kuiper.log追溯问题。
3. 安全加固方案
- 传输加密:启用TLS 1.3协议,证书管理推荐使用Let’s Encrypt。
- 访问控制:通过JWT令牌实现API鉴权,示例配置:
{"authentication": {"type": "jwt","secret": "your-256-bit-secret","algorithm": "HS256"}}
- 固件签名:使用cosign工具对Kuiper镜像进行SBOM签名,防止供应链攻击。
五、未来演进方向
- AI融合:集成ONNX Runtime实现边缘端轻量化模型推理,支持TensorFlow Lite格式部署。
- 联邦学习:开发安全聚合协议,使多个边缘节点在数据不出域的前提下协同训练全局模型。
- 数字孪生:与Unity 3D等引擎对接,构建物理设备的实时数字镜像,支持AR远程运维。
Kuiper边缘计算框架通过其精简的架构设计、强大的流处理能力及灵活的扩展机制,正在成为工业4.0、智慧城市等领域的关键基础设施。开发者可通过LF Edge基金会获取完整文档与案例库,结合具体场景进行二次开发,快速构建高可靠的边缘智能应用。

发表评论
登录后可评论,请前往 登录 或 注册